Eagles At The Headwaters




I was passing over Shingle Creek on Central Florida Parkway yesterday afternoon, when I spotted and photographed this eagle pair on a utility pole overlooking the creek.
Knowing my exact location at the time, curiosity prodded me later to see if I could discover an aerial image using Earth Map programs on the computer (highlighted circles).
Unpretentious Shingle Creek, itself originating in Pine Hills, forms the headwaters for the Everglades.
